Can somebody help me what is S1841PB-12411XJ IOS ????? How can i see whether i have that IOS or not ???

I tried

sh ver

sh diag

sh platform

dir flash:

almost everything I knew but I couldnt get that. Can i get the exact keyword S1841PB-12411XJ while typing some commmand.

The issue is we had ordered a 1841 router , the vendor has listed

S1841PB-12411XJ - 1 No.

I couldnt understand this.

Help !!!!!!!

show ver is the one.

I *suspect* there may be a typo in there. Add an "I" and you get the order code for IP Base. Note the order code is *NOT* the filename.

The order code is S184IPB-12411XJ

I can normally work back from the file name to IOS, but the other way is more challenging. Post the output of a she ver and I can confirm hat you have. I would expect the filename the image is loaded from to look something like c1841-ipbase-mz.124-11.XJ.bin for that particular version.

That is early deployment software. Unless you have some urgent need for sothig supported only in that software I would not recommend you use it. I would suggest something like IP Base 12.4.17 that should be more stable.
